High-end Server processor released in 2017 with 4 cores and 8 threads. With base clock at 3.8GHz, max speed at 4.2GHz, and a 72W power rating. Xeon E3-1270 V6 is based on the Kaby Lake-S 14nm family and part of the Xeon E3 series.
